A 25 °Bx sucrose solution has 25 grams of sucrose per 100 grams of liquid; or, to put it another way, 25 grams of sucrose sugar and 75 grams of water exist in the 100 grams of solution. Solubility of sucrose in water is of fundamental importance in defining the supersaturation, or driving force of sucrose crystal growth.
